AUCKLAND FLOUR.

ANOTHER ADVANCE IN PRICE. By Telegraph—Press Association. Auckland, last night. The price of Auckland hour advanced os per ton to-day, and Hour is now quoted at £ll ss, or 5s below the Dunedin price. The millers state that the rise is caused by the farmers not threshing, many keeping the bulk of the wheat back in anticipation of the rising market. It is not expected, however, that the price of local liour will advance much, if anything, beyond the price quoted above,
